Output 58970261299ba4f1ef6910e16f9025fff2a365fd0e2e8a3929479ae582c548ae: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04ad4b5057810b62e0ed422d5ae8b8f4349e4991 OP_EQUAL
address
327kE17heNur3nLhupFMiVf1PuLyx8p4Pu
transaction
58970261299ba4f1ef6910e16f9025fff2a365fd0e2e8a3929479ae582c548ae
spent
true